What does the Chinese surname Du (Dù) 杜 mean?
杜 Du (Dù) is the #54 most common Chinese surname with approximately Under 1 million people. Du (杜) originally referred to the birch-leaf pear tree or a place with such trees. It symbolizes strength, resilience, and natural beauty. The surname is associated with wood elements and steadfastness.

기원 및 역사
The Du surname originated from the ancient state of Du during the Shang and Zhou Dynasties. Some descendants of Emperor Yao adopted Du as their surname, while others came from the Tang state that was renamed Du.

Du씨의 유명한 사람
Du Fu (杜甫) — Tang Dynasty poet, one of China's greatest literary figures
Du Mu (杜牧) — Tang Dynasty poet and official
Du Ruhui (杜如晦) — Tang Dynasty chancellor and strategist
